Why Aquarium Weight Matters

Physics determines that water weighs around 8.34 pounds per gallon (or about 1 kg per liter) at room temperature. When confined in a glass box, that weight multiplies rapidly.

Neglecting the total weight of an aquarium can cause disastrous consequences, consisting of:

  • Flooring Damage: Sagging floorboards, cracked tiles, or deforming wood.
  • Structural Failure: In serious cases, unsupported floors can collapse, triggering huge home damage.
  • Tank Rupture: If a stand or floor droops unevenly, the pressure circulation on the aquarium modifications. This develops tension points on the silicone seams, potentially resulting in leaks or total tank failure.

The Formula: How to Calculate Fish Tank Weight

To discover the real overall weight of a set-up aquarium, one must represent 4 primary parts:

  1. Empty Tank Weight: The glass or acrylic structure itself.
  2. Water Weight: The volume of water increased by 8.34 lbs/gallon.
  3. Substrate Weight: Gravel, sand, or aquasoil.
  4. Design and Equipment: Rocks, driftwood, filters, and lighting fixtures.

The standard formula looks like this:

Basic Aquarium Sizes and Weights (Reference Table)

To make preparing much easier, the table below lays out the estimated filled weight of common aquarium sizes. Bear in mind that these numbers assume basic glass tanks filled with water, a typical layer of gravel, and standard decoration.

Tank Size (Gallons) Approximate Dimensions (L x W x H) Empty Weight (pounds) Estimated Filled Weight (lbs) Estimated Filled Weight (kg)
5 Gallon 16″ x 8″ x 10″ 7 lbs |55 pounds |25 kg
10 Gallon 20″ x 10″ x 12″ 11 lbs |110 lbs |50 kg
20 Gallon High 24″ x 12″ x 16″ 25 pounds |225 lbs |102 kg
20 Gallon Long 30″ x 12″ x 12″ 26 lbs |220 lbs |100 kg
29 Gallon 30″ x 12″ x 18″ 33 pounds |330 pounds |150 kg
40 Gallon Breeder 36″ x 18″ x 16″ 55 pounds |450 pounds |204 kg
55 Gallon 48″ x 13″ x 21″ 78 lbs |625 pounds |283 kg
75 Gallon 48″ x 18″ x 21″ 120 lbs |850 pounds |385 kg
90 Gallon 48″ x 18″ x 24″ 140 lbs |1,050 lbs |476 kg
125 Gallon 72″ x 18″ x 22″ 215 lbs |1,400 lbs |635 kg

Note: Acrylic tanks are generally 40% to 50% lighter than glass tanks of the same volume, though the water weight remains similar.


Beyond the Water: Factoring in Substrate and Hardscape

While water constitutes the vast bulk of an aquarium’s weight, the interior components can add a surprising number of pounds to the final tally.

1. Substrate (Sand and Gravel)

Most fish tanks require a 1-to-2-inch layer of substrate.

  • Standard Gravel/Sand: Weighs approximately 100 pounds per cubic foot when wet.
  • Aquasoil (Planted Tank Substrate): Generally lighter and more porous, weighing around 50 to 60 pounds per cubic foot when saturated.

Guideline: For a basic 55-gallon tank, plan on adding 50 to 75 pounds of substrate.

2. Rocks and Driftwood

Aquascaping typically involves heavy materials like Seiyriu stone, Dragon stone, or thick woods like Mopani.

  • Dense rocks can weigh anywhere from 50 to 100+ pounds in a heavily scaped tank (such as an Iwagumi layout).
  • Water-logged driftwood soaks up moisture, adding much more weight to the setup.

Where Should You Place Your Tank? Floor Safety Guidelines

Understanding the total weight is only half the battle; understanding where to put the tank is where structural security comes into play.

Floor Joists and Load-Bearing Walls

  • Perpendicular Placement: Always place big fish tanks (55 gallons and up) perpendicular to the flooring joists. This disperses the weight throughout multiple joists rather than concentrating it on simply a couple of parallel beams.
  • Near Load-Bearing Walls: Position heavy tanks near to exterior walls or interior bearing walls. Floorings are naturally stronger and experience less deflection near the structural assistances of a home.

2nd Floor vs. Ground Floor

  • Concrete Slabs (Ground Floor/Basement): Concrete can support essentially any domestic aquarium weight without concern. Weight circulation is hardly ever a concern here.
  • Wooden Subfloors (Upper Stories): Standard property structure codes usually need floorings to support a “live load” of 30 to 40 pounds per square foot. Nevertheless, a big Aquarium Pump Calculator produces a high “concentrated load.”
    • Example: A 75-gallon tank footprint is approximately 48″ x 18″ (6 square feet). Weighing 850 pounds total, that translates to over 140 pounds per square foot— well above standard minimum building regulations. For that reason, upper-story placements for big tanks require careful structural examination.

Tips for Safely Supporting a Heavy Aquarium

If you are planning a medium-to-large aquarium setup, consider the following finest practices to make sure safety:

  • Invest in a Rated Stand: Never put an Aquarium Size on makeshift furniture like old cabinets or lightweight desks. Aquarium stands are specifically crafted to support vertical loads and avoid twisting.
  • Use Leveling Mats: Uneven floors create pressure points on the bottom glass pane. Use a self-leveling foam mat beneath rimless glass tanks to distribute weight equally.
  • Seek Advice From a Structural Engineer: If you are installing a tank bigger than 90 gallons on the 2nd floor of an older home, consulting an expert contractor or structural engineer provides peace of mind.
